WHY CHOOSE PEAR ENGAGEMENT RINGS?

Pear shaped engagement rings have a teardrop centre stone with one rounded end and one pointed tip. If you are looking at pear styles you probably want an elongated, distinctive outline that still feels soft and graceful.

HOW TO CHOOSE A PEAR ENGAGEMENT RING

Choosing a pear shaped engagement ring means checking the balance of the stone and protecting the point.

  • Check the bow tie and symmetry: Look for a soft, balanced bow tie through the centre and a point that lines up with the rounded end.
  • Choose the ratio: A length-to-width ratio around 1.50 to 1.70 reads graceful, while a longer ratio feels more dramatic.
  • Protect the point: Look for a V-prong, bezel or chevron-style head that covers the pointed tip for daily wear.
